Unveiling User Needs Through Surveys: Choosing the Right Tool for the Job
Understanding user needs is crucial to developing successful products and services. Performing surveys is a popular approach for gathering valuable insights into user desires. With a wide range of survey tools available, choosing the right one can be tricky.
To make sure your surveys are effective, consider the following factors:
- Target audience: Different survey tools cater to different user demographics and technical literacy levels.
- Survey complexity: Some tools are better suited for brief surveys, while others can handle more detailed questionnaires.
- Functionality: Consider what features are important for your survey, such as branching logic, data visualization, and reporting customization.
By carefully evaluating your needs and exploring the options, you can opt for the perfect survey tool to reveal valuable user insights.
